Evidence-Based Approaches That Really Function

Exposure and Response Avoidance treatment represents the gold standard for OCD therapy, with decades of research supporting its performance. Unlike standard talk treatment that could unintentionally reinforce compulsive behaviors, ERP directly attends to the cycle of fascinations and obsessions by gradually exposing individuals to anxiety-triggering scenarios while stopping the typical compulsive feedback. This technique re-trains the mind's threat discovery system, helping clients build tolerance to uncertainty and pain without resorting to rituals or evasion habits.

Quality OCD treatment companies comprehend that contamination concerns, invasive thoughts, inspecting habits, and mental obsessions all call for tailored direct exposure power structures. The specialist's role involves thoroughly creating these pecking orders, starting with reasonably challenging direct exposures and progressively proceeding towards circumstances that previously seemed difficult to deal with. This methodical desensitization, incorporated with cognitive restructuring, produces enduring adjustment instead than short-lived alleviation.

Specialized Support for Disordered Consuming Patterns

The crossway in between anxiety disorders and disordered consuming often goes unacknowledged, yet these conditions regularly exist together. Restrictive eating, binge actions, and food-related rituals can all function as anxiousness monitoring techniques that ultimately worsen psychological wellness outcomes. Efficient therapy addresses both the eating habits and the underlying anxiety driving them, acknowledging that restriction often represents an attempt to control uncertainty or take care of frustrating emotions.

Therapists concentrating on this location utilize a combination of direct exposure therapy for food worries, cognitive behavior methods for altered thinking patterns, and mindfulness-based methods to increase understanding of appetite hints and psychological triggers. Instead than concentrating solely on weight remediation or dish strategies, extensive treatment takes a look at the function these habits serve in the customer's life and establishes healthier coping mechanisms for managing distress.

Injury Treatment: Handling What Can't Be Forgotten

Trauma influences the nervous system in manner ins which chat treatment alone can not constantly address. Whether taking care of single-incident trauma or complex developing trauma, efficient treatment requires comprehending just how past experiences continue influencing existing working. Many individuals with trauma histories develop stress and anxiety disorders or OCD as attempts to avoid future harm or handle frustrating feelings linked to terrible memories.

Evidence-based injury treatments like EMDR (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ing), trauma-focused CBT, and somatic experiencing assistance customers process traumatic memories without becoming overwhelmed or retraumatized. These approaches identify that trauma lives in the body along with the mind, including nerve system law strategies together with cognitive handling. The objective isn't to forget what happened however to lower the psychological cost and intrusive nature of traumatic memories, permitting clients to incorporate their experiences as opposed to staying regulated by them.
